Monro Reload Bonus: 50% up to EUR 150 Every Friday
The welcome match fires once. After that, the offer that keeps an account company is the reload bonus — a deposit bonus written for players who already have a profile. The percentage is smaller, but it comes back week after week. At Monro the reload runs on Fridays: 50% of the top-up, a ceiling of EUR 150, and a multiplier of x35. Below are the conditions in figures, without promotional adjectives. Written for readers aged 18 and over.
What a reload actually does
A reload is a match deposit applied to a repeat payment. Formally it can be the second deposit bonus or the twentieth: the cashier does not count how many times you have funded the account, it checks the day of the week and whether the offer has already been used in the current week. The rate sits below the welcome level precisely because the promotion returns instead of appearing once.
Mechanically nothing changes from the starter deal. The credited money arrives on its own balance line and stays locked until the requirement is cleared. Only the figures move: x35 instead of x40, EUR 150 instead of EUR 300. The minimum deposit is EUR 20 and the clearing window is 14 days.
Weekly bonus against monthly bonus
A weekly bonus like the Friday reload is engineered for small, regular use. A EUR 50 payment produces EUR 25 of bonus and EUR 875 of turnover, which is one unhurried evening in slots. A monthly bonus, which some sites run instead, is larger in cash but drags a requirement spread across weeks, and that is exactly the kind of obligation people fail to finish.
Monro chose the weekly rhythm, and for a player on a fixed entertainment budget that is the friendlier design. You know the offer returns next Friday, so there is no pressure to fund the account today simply because a campaign is about to close.
Activation sequence
- Log in on a Friday and open the promotions area or the cashier.
- Confirm the reload is live and that you have not already used it this week.
- Tick the offer BEFORE the payment leaves — reloads are not attached retroactively.
- Deposit at least EUR 20, or EUR 25 if you are using a SEPA transfer.
- Check the bonus balance line and start putting turnover through it.
Reload terms most people skim past
- One activation per week: a second Friday payment will simply arrive without a bonus.
- Reload progress is tracked in isolation and never merges with another bonus counter.
- The EUR 5 maximum stake per spin applies here exactly as it does to the welcome offer.
- Weighting is unchanged: slots 100%, live tables and table games 10%, sports betting 0%.
- Crypto deposits take 10 to 60 minutes to land, which is worth planning around on a Friday evening.
Minimum deposit and what it buys
The min deposit is the line below which no bonus is issued at all. For Trustly, Skrill, Visa, Mastercard and paysafecard that line is EUR 20; SEPA transfers start at EUR 25 and crypto at roughly EUR 50. A smaller payment still reaches your balance as an ordinary deposit, it simply carries no promotion. Above the minimum the bonus scales with the payment until EUR 150, after which extra money adds nothing to the reward — so a EUR 300 Friday deposit earns the same EUR 150 as a EUR 400 one.
How the reload compares with the rest
Set against the welcome bonus the reload is smaller but more honest: by the time you claim it you already know the cashier, you know how fast Trustly pays out, and you know whether x35 fits your pace. Set against cashback it demands a decision in advance — deposit first, bonus second — whereas cashback accrues from whatever you were doing anyway.
The calmest combination for a regular looks like this: claim the reload only on a Friday when you were going to top up regardless, let cashback run silently in the background, and skip any offer that would change how you play.
